Pumpkin Spice Hot Chocolate


  • Author: Jennifer
  • Total Time: 15 minutes
  • Yield: Serves 2

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ups whole milk (or almond/oat milk)
  • 2 tablespoons un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 1/2 cup canned pumpkin puree
  • 2 tablespoons brown sugar (adjust to taste)
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 teaspoon pumpkin pie spice
  • Whipped cream for topping

Instructions

  1. In a saucepan over medium heat, warm the milk until steaming but not boiling.
  2. Whisk in cocoa powder and pumpkin puree until smooth.
  3. Stir in brown sugar until dissolved.
  4. Add vanilla extract and pumpkin pie spice; mix well.
  5. Pour into mugs and top with whipped cream and extra pumpkin pie spice if desired.
